Output 9485682fe80e23dfc6768fa5876418265ae3f53a2572281cadc0759c463eb105:5

value
380370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70283d754ecff3ac12a525b73a8c08dbec9efaf OP_EQUAL
address
3QD5qftyi38cRJvGdkHL58Kx4u53y76NWN
transaction
9485682fe80e23dfc6768fa5876418265ae3f53a2572281cadc0759c463eb105
spent
true